Duties and Responsibilities:
- Work with Maintenance Director on scheduling changes and attendance issues in the department.
- Provide and forward in an expeditious manner any community complaints and concerns to the Maintenance Director
- Communicate when information needs to be passed on to other Housekeepers.
- Notify Maintenance Director about discipline issues in the department.
- Work with other housekeepers to ensure proper cleaning is being performed throughout the community.
- Follow Gencare Lifestyle move-in policy
- Assist residents with daily problems and concerns (non-caregiver inquiries, however, will forward immediately any caregiver questions to management)
- Notify Maintenance Director of cleaning supplies as needed
- Document any repairs needed in the maintenance logbook, however immediately report any major repairs to the Executive Director and safety issues to the appropriate Safety Committee member
- Assist with team member training and covering other shifts if required
